Everdell is such a cute game you could almost, but not quite, forget it’s hyper competitive.
In the charming valley of Everdell you develop a full-fledged city attracting all sorts of forest critters. You make them thrive and expand over the course of 4 seasons.
What I love about it is how many paths to victory there are and yet in general you end up within a few points of each other.
It’s a really fun game and it’s great for beginners and advanced players too.
